IE5 고효율 모터 시장 규모는 최근 급성장하고 있습니다. 2025년 26억 달러로 평가되었습니다. 2026년에는 29억 9,000만 달러에 이르고, CAGR 14.8%로 성장할 전망입니다. 과거의 이러한 성장은 산업용 전력 소비량 증가, 고효율 모터 기준의 확대 적용, 제조 자동화 시스템의 보급, 최소 에너지 성능 기준에 관한 규제의 추진, 그리고 HVAC(공조·환기·냉난방) 및 펌프 시스템의 도입 확대에 기인한 것으로 보입니다.

IE5 고효율 모터 시장 규모는 향후 몇 년간 급성장이 전망되고 있습니다. 2030년까지 52억 3,000만 달러에 이르고, CAGR은 15.0%를 나타낼 전망입니다. 예측 기간 동안의 성장 요인으로는 초고효율 산업용 모터에 대한 수요 증가, 전동 모빌리티 인프라의 확대, 스마트 팩토리의 성장 및 인더스트리 4.0 도입 확대, 탄소 배출 감축 목표에 대한 관심 고조, IoT 기반 모터 모니터링 시스템의 통합이 진행되고 있는 점 등을 들 수 있습니다. 예측 기간 동안의 주요 동향으로는 산업용 자동화 시스템에 고효율 모터의 도입, HVAC(냉난방 및 공조) 에너지 최적화 용도에 IE5 모터의 통합, 모터 효율 향상을 위한 첨단 희토류 자성 재료의 활용, 예측 유지보수를 가능하게 하는 스마트 모터 시스템, 그리고 소형이면서 높은 토크 밀도를 갖춘 모터 설계의 최적화 등이 있습니다.

탄소 배출량 감축에 대한 관심이 높아짐에 따라, 향후 몇 년 동안 IE5 고효율 모터 시장의 성장이 촉진될 것으로 예측됩니다. 탄소 배출량 감축이란, 기후 변화를 완화하기 위해 온실가스, 특히 이산화탄소의 대기 중 배출을 줄이는 것을 목적으로 하는 노력을 말합니다. 기후 변화 대책의 일환으로 온실가스 배출 감축을 의무화하는 정부 규제가 점점 더 엄격해지고 있어, 탄소 배출량 감축에 대한 관심이 높아지고 있습니다. 탄소 배출량 감축에 대한 관심이 높아짐에 따라, 산업계가 에너지 소비를 최소화하고 가동 중 온실가스 배출량을 대폭 줄이는 초고효율 기술로 전환하는 과정에서 IE5 고효율 모터의 도입이 촉진되고 있습니다. 예를 들어, 2024년 3월, 프랑스에 본부를 둔 자율적인 정부 간 기구인 국제에너지기구(IEA)에 따르면, 청정 에너지의 확대가 전 세계 배출량 증가를 억제하는 데 기여하여 2023년 배출량 증가율은 불과 1.1%에 그쳤습니다. 따라서 탄소 배출량 감축에 대한 관심이 높아지면서 IE5 고효율 모터 시장의 성장을 이끌고 있습니다.

IE5 고효율 모터 시장에서 사업을 전개하는 주요 기업들은 에너지 효율 향상, 운영 비용 절감 및 산업의 탈탄소화를 지원하기 위해 수냉식 동기 릴랙턴스 모터(SynRM)와 같은 혁신적인 제품 개발에 주력하고 있습니다. 액체 냉각식 동기 릴랙턴스 모터(SynRM)는 자석을 사용하지 않는 로터 설계와 액체 냉각 시스템을 결합한 첨단 전기 모터로, 에너지 손실을 최소화하고 방열 성능을 향상시킴으로써 기존의 공랭식 유도 모터에 비해 산업 분야에서 더 높은 효율, 더 낮은 운영 비용, 그리고 더 높은 신뢰성을 갖춘 성능을 실현하는 데 기여하고 있습니다. 예를 들어, 2024년 2월, 스위스에 본사를 둔 전기·자동화 기업 ABB Ltd.는 IE5 고효율 모터 분야의 혁신적인 제품인 수냉식 IE5 SynRM 모터를 출시했습니다. 이 모터는 희토류 소재에 대한 의존도를 없애면서도 IE5 기준을 상회하는 효율 수준을 실현하는 자석 없는 로터 설계를 특징으로 합니다. 또한, 열을 효과적으로 방출하는 첨단 액체 냉각 채널을 탑재하여 고부하 상태에서도 연속 운전이 가능하도록 하며, 시스템 전체의 성능을 향상시킵니다. 컴팩트한 설계로 공간을 효율적으로 활용할 수 있을 뿐만 아니라, 에너지 소비량 감소와 작동 온도 저하를 통해 장비의 수명 연장과 유지보수 부담 경감에 기여합니다. 이 모터는 화학 처리, 선박 산업, 중공업 등 가혹한 사용 환경에 특히 적합합니다.

IE5 efficiency motors are high-end ultra-premium electric motors developed to reach the highest energy efficiency rating established by international standards, substantially lowering electrical losses compared with lower efficiency classes. These motors commonly employ advanced technologies including enhanced magnetic materials, improved rotor configurations, and highly precise production methods to maximize performance.

The primary product types of IE5 efficiency motors include alternating current (AC) motors, direct current (DC) motors, synchronous motors, and asynchronous motors. Alternating current (AC) motors refer to high-efficiency electric motors engineered to operate on alternating current while providing enhanced energy savings and performance in industrial and commercial settings. These motors are segmented based on power output, including up to 1 horsepower (HP), 1-5 horsepower (HP), 6-20 horsepower (HP), and above 20 horsepower (HP). They are applied across industrial, commercial, residential, automotive, heating, ventilation, and air conditioning (HVAC), and other sectors, and are utilized by end users such as manufacturing, oil and gas, utilities, mining, transportation, and others.

Tariffs are affecting IE5 efficiency motor market by raising costs of imported high-grade magnetic materials, precision components, and advanced motor manufacturing equipment used in ultra-high-efficiency motor production. This is disrupting global supply chains and increasing production expenses, especially in import-reliant regions like Asia-Pacific and Europe. Industrial motors, HVAC systems, and high-output motor segments are most impacted due to dependence on specialized foreign-sourced components. However, tariffs are also driving localized manufacturing, diversification of supply chains, and greater investment in domestic production of energy-efficient motor technologies, ultimately improving regional industrial self-reliance.

The IE5 efficiency motors market size has grown rapidly in recent years. It will grow from $2.6 billion in 2025 to $2.99 billion in 2026 at a compound annual growth rate (CAGR) of 14.8%. The growth in the historic period can be attributed to rising industrial electricity consumption, increasing adoption of energy efficient motor standards, growth in manufacturing automation systems, regulatory push for minimum energy performance standards, expansion of HVAC and pump system installations.

The IE5 efficiency motors market size is expected to see rapid growth in the next few years. It will grow to $5.23 billion by 2030 at a compound annual growth rate (CAGR) of 15.0%. The growth in the forecast period can be attributed to increasing demand for ultra high efficiency industrial motors, expansion of electric mobility infrastructure, growth in smart factories and Industry 4.0 adoption, rising focus on carbon emission reduction targets, increasing integration of IoT based motor monitoring systems. Major trends in the forecast period include high efficiency motor adoption in industrial automation systems, IE5 motors integration in HVAC energy optimization applications, advanced rare earth magnetic material utilization for motor efficiency, predictive maintenance enabled smart motor systems, compact high torque density motor design optimization.

The growing focus on reducing carbon emissions is anticipated to propel the growth of the IE5 efficiency motors market in coming years. Reducing carbon emissions refers to efforts aimed at lowering the release of greenhouse gases, particularly carbon dioxide, into the atmosphere to mitigate climate change. The focus on reducing carbon emissions is rising due to increasingly strict government regulations that mandate lower greenhouse gas emissions to combat climate change. Focus on reducing carbon emissions supports the adoption of IE5 efficiency motors as industries shift toward ultra-high efficiency technologies that minimize energy consumption and significantly lower greenhouse gas emissions during industrial operations. For instance, in March 2024, according to the International Energy Agency (IEA), a France-based autonomous intergovernmental organization, the expansion of clean energy has helped curb the growth of global emissions, which rose by only 1.1% in 2023. Therefore, the growing focus on reducing carbon emissions is driving the growth of the IE5 efficiency motors market.

Leading companies operating in the IE5 efficiency motors market are focusing on developing innovative products such as liquid-cooled synchronous reluctance motors (SynRM) to enhance energy efficiency, reduce operational costs, and support industrial decarbonization. Liquid-cooled synchronous reluctance motors (SynRM) are advanced electric motors that utilize a magnet-free rotor design along with a liquid cooling system to minimize energy losses and improve heat dissipation, helping industries achieve higher efficiency, lower operating costs, and more reliable performance compared to conventional air-cooled induction motors. For example, in February 2024, ABB Ltd., a Switzerland-based electrification and automation company, launched its liquid-cooled IE5 SynRM motor, an innovative product in the IE5 efficiency motors segment. This motor features a magnet-free rotor design that removes dependency on rare earth materials while still achieving efficiency levels exceeding IE5 standards. It incorporates advanced liquid cooling channels that effectively dissipate heat, enabling continuous operation under high loads and improving overall system performance. The compact design enhances space utilization, while reduced energy consumption and lower operating temperatures contribute to extended equipment lifespan and reduced maintenance requirements. The motor is particularly suitable for demanding applications such as chemical processing, marine industries, and heavy-duty manufacturing.

In July 2023, Esautomotion S. r. l., an Italy-based manufacturing enterprise, completed the acquisition of Sangalli Servomotori S. r. l. for a value of $11 million. Through this acquisition, Esautomotion S. r. l. sought to enhance its supply chain integration, broaden its range of high-efficiency electric motors, and speed up expansion into green automation and electric mobility sectors while improving its capability to deliver complete automation solutions and reach new international clients. Sangalli Servomotori S. r. l. is an Italy-based manufacturing firm specializing in the production of high-performance electric motors.

Asia-Pacific was the dominating region in the IE5 efficiency motors market in 2025. Asia Pacific is expected to be the rapidly expanding region during the forecast period. The IE5 efficiency motors market consists of sales of standard IE5 motors, high-torque IE5 motors, permanent magnet synchronous IE5 motors, low-voltage IE5 motors, and high-voltage IE5 motors. Values in this market are 'factory gate' values, meaning the value of goods sold by the manufacturers, whether to distributors, wholesalers, system integrators, or directly to end customers. The market value also includes related services provided by manufacturers, such as installation support, technical guidance, and maintenance assistance.

The market value is defined as the revenues that enterprises gain from the sale of goods and/or services within the specified market and geography through sales, grants, or donations in terms of the currency (in USD unless otherwise specified).

The revenues for a specified geography are consumption values that are revenues generated by organizations in the specified geography within the market, irrespective of where they are produced. It does not include revenues from resales along the supply chain, either further along the supply chain or as part of other products.
